Former Cubs All-Star Bryan LaHair Signs in Japan
Published at(FUKUOKA, Japan) — Former Chicago Cub Bryan LaHair has signed a two-year $4.5 million contract with the Softbank Hawks of the Japanese Pacific League.
2012 was the 29-year-old LaHair’s first full MLB season. He hit .259, with 16 home runs and 40 RBI’s, making the National League All-Star team.
In 970 Minor League games, LaHair hit .295, with 159 home runs and had a .362 OBP.
LaHair is expected to be used as a first baseman and designated hitter for the Hawks.
